Abstract

The disclosed polymers comprise ethylene, one or more higher alkenes-1 having 3-18 carbon atoms in an amount of 0 to 15 mole.-% calculated on the ethylene, and such a small amount of one or more poly-unsaturated compounds having at least 7 carbon atoms and at least two non-conjugated double bonds polymerizable under the influence of transition metal catalysts wherein the activation energy of the viscous flow of the polymer is not significantly influenced by the presence of the poly-unsaturated compound(s).
